Need Some Help - No Grains
If anyone can help me out, I'd greatly appreciate it. I'll start by telling you about what I'm looking for.
My wife and I are going to try doing a month with no grains. (little to no grains), and we plan on starting on September 15th. I will eat anything...any ethnic variations, any type of foods, anything really...even the wonderful unidentifiable things I enjoyed when I was living in China for a little bit. My wife...well, she likes meat, potatoes and basic pastas. She likes fruits and peanut butter..stuff like that. She does not like many vegetables at all. What I'm looking for is a link to a site that may help me plan out a month of recipes that will give us the carbs/nutrients we need, without resorting to breads/pastas/rice, and that may provide it without her relying on eating too many green vegetables. I don't know if that can be done in a healthy way, but thats where I am, unfortunately. I'll still be eating spinach, broccolli etc... |

Re: Need Some Help - No Grains
well you don't have to eat pounds of veggies a day or anything, there is no 'minimum' requirment for carbs per day. If you are doing zone i suppose you will be wanting to get x grams per day, but you can always replace carbs with fat if you can't get the x grams in.
yes there are tons of 'grain free' recipes out there (georges recipe blog), apparently you can do amazing things with cauliflower |
